How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 10601?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 10601 Studio Apartments | $2,747 | $1,895 | $3,443 |
| 10601 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,652 | $2,425 | $7,473 |
| 10601 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,055 | $3,140 | $9,118 |
| 10601 3 Bedroom Apartments | $6,893 | $3,495 | $11,804 |
